You might be right with the 16RB. I compared the 1980 brochure that has a floor plan listing and the features on the outside of the camper comes closest to the 16RB. This assumes the 16RB in 1981 did not change much which are pretty good odds.

The shower in these older ones may have been a "wet bath" I think they called it. There would be no shower stall per say. The bath floor would be made that it was the basin bottom. And the walls were made they could get wet and drain to the floor drain. I'm not positive on this. Maybe one of of older camper member could help on the "wet bath" methods.
